Pay range, side by side
| Percentile | Actuary | Business Analyst |
|---|---|---|
| Entry (10th) | $133,971 | $86,368 |
| 25th | $168,778 | $108,805 |
| Median | $203,596 | $131,252 |
| 75th | $246,145 | $158,681 |
| Senior (90th) | $288,704 | $186,120 |
National Sweden figures in SEK. Individual pay varies with experience, employer, and location.
